admin管理员组文章数量:1567037
2024年5月12日发(作者:)
SIM卡通信原理
SIM(Subscriber Identity Module)卡是一种集成电路卡片,用于存储和管理用
户的个人信息,以及与移动网络运营商进行通信。SIM卡通信原理涉及到SIM卡与
设备、移动网络运营商之间的通信过程,包括SIM卡的识别、鉴权、加密等功能。
本文将详细解释SIM卡通信原理的基本原理。
1. SIM卡的基本结构
SIM卡通信原理的基础是SIM卡的基本结构。SIM卡通常由塑料卡片和集成电路芯
片组成。集成电路芯片中包含了存储器、处理器和通信接口等组件。
•
•
•
存储器:用于存储用户的个人信息、短信、联系人等数据。存储器通常包括
可编程只读存储器(EEPROM)和随机存储器(RAM)。
处理器:用于处理SIM卡内部的逻辑运算和数据处理。处理器通常是一个嵌
入式微控制器,具有较强的计算能力。
通信接口:用于与设备或移动网络运营商进行通信。通信接口通常包括物理
接口和逻辑接口。
2. SIM卡的识别和鉴权
SIM卡通信的第一步是识别和鉴权过程。设备在与SIM卡进行通信之前,首先需要
识别SIM卡的存在并进行鉴权,以确保通信的安全性和合法性。这一过程通常包括
以下步骤:
•
•
•
•
插入SIM卡:用户将SIM卡插入设备的SIM卡槽中。
电源供给:设备为SIM卡提供电源,使其能够正常工作。
识别SIM卡:设备通过读取SIM卡中的信息,识别SIM卡的类型和运营商信
息。
鉴权:设备向SIM卡发送鉴权请求,SIM卡通过验证设备的身份和权限,确
定是否允许设备接入移动网络。
SIM卡的识别和鉴权过程是SIM卡通信的基础,确保了通信的安全性和合法性。
3. SIM卡与设备的通信
SIM卡与设备之间的通信是通过物理接口和逻辑接口实现的。物理接口是指SIM卡
与设备之间的电气连接,逻辑接口是指SIM卡与设备之间的数据传输和控制协议。
3.1 物理接口
物理接口是指SIM卡与设备之间的电气连接方式。SIM卡通常采用ISO/IEC 7816
标准定义的接口规范,包括物理尺寸、电气特性和引脚定义等。
ISO/IEC 7816标准规定了SIM卡的物理尺寸分为三种:ID-1、ID-000和ID-00。
其中,ID-1尺寸是最常见的尺寸,与信用卡大小相同,适用于大多数手机和移动
设备。ID-000尺寸较小,适用于一些特殊设备,如蓝牙耳机。ID-00尺寸更小,适
用于一些超小型设备,如智能手表。
SIM卡的物理接口通常包括金属接点和塑料插槽。设备通过金属接点与SIM卡的引
脚进行电气连接,实现与SIM卡之间的数据传输和控制。
3.2 逻辑接口
逻辑接口是指SIM卡与设备之间的数据传输和控制协议。SIM卡通信常用的逻辑接
口协议有两种:ISO/IEC 7816和SIM Application Toolkit(SAT)。
ISO/IEC 7816是SIM卡通信的基本协议,定义了SIM卡与设备之间的数据传输格
式和指令集。设备通过发送指令给SIM卡,SIM卡执行指令并返回结果。ISO/IEC
7816协议支持两种数据传输方式:T=0和T=1。T=0是基于字符的传输方式,T=1
是基于块的传输方式。
SIM Application Toolkit(SAT)是一种在SIM卡上运行的应用程序框架,提供了
一系列与设备交互的命令和功能。设备可以通过发送SAT命令给SIM卡,SIM卡执
行命令并返回结果。SAT可以用于实现一些增值服务,如短信、电话本管理等。
逻辑接口协议的选择取决于设备的支持情况和应用需求。
4. SIM卡与移动网络运营商的通信
SIM卡与移动网络运营商之间的通信是通过移动网络进行的。SIM卡在接入移动网
络之前,需要与运营商进行鉴权和注册过程。
4.1 鉴权和注册
SIM卡接入移动网络之前,需要与运营商进行鉴权和注册。鉴权是指SIM卡通过验
证设备的身份和权限,确定是否允许设备接入移动网络。注册是指SIM卡将自己的
信息注册到移动网络中,以便运营商能够正确识别和管理SIM卡。
鉴权和注册过程通常包括以下步骤:
•
•
•
•
寻找运营商:SIM卡首先搜索可用的移动网络运营商,并选择一个合适的运
营商进行接入。
鉴权请求:SIM卡向运营商发送鉴权请求,包括SIM卡的识别信息和鉴权密
钥等。
鉴权验证:运营商通过验证SIM卡的识别信息和鉴权密钥,确定SIM卡的合
法性和权限。
注册请求:SIM卡向运营商发送注册请求,包括SIM卡的个人信息和服务需
求等。
• 注册确认:运营商确认SIM卡的注册请求,并将SIM卡的信息记录到移动网
络中。
鉴权和注册过程确保了SIM卡与运营商之间的合法和安全通信。
4.2 数据通信
SIM卡接入移动网络之后,可以与运营商进行数据通信。数据通信包括短信、电话、
数据传输等。SIM卡通过移动网络与运营商进行数据传输和交互。
数据通信的过程通常包括以下步骤:
•
•
•
数据传输请求:设备向SIM卡发送数据传输请求,包括目标地址、数据内容
等。
数据传输确认:SIM卡确认数据传输请求,并将数据传输到指定的目标地址。
数据传输结果:SIM卡将数据传输结果返回给设备,设备根据结果进行相应
处理。
数据通信是SIM卡与运营商之间的主要功能之一,支持了短信、电话、数据传输等
业务的实现。
5. SIM卡的安全性
SIM卡通信原理中的一个重要方面是安全性。SIM卡通过鉴权、加密等机制保障通
信的安全性。
5.1 鉴权
鉴权是SIM卡通信中的一个重要环节,用于验证设备的身份和权限。SIM卡通过鉴
权机制,确保只有合法设备才能接入移动网络。
鉴权过程中,设备需要提供识别信息和鉴权密钥等,SIM卡通过验证这些信息来确
定设备的合法性和权限。鉴权机制可以防止非法设备接入移动网络,保护通信的安
全性。
5.2 加密
SIM卡通信中的另一个重要机制是加密。加密机制用于保护通信内容的机密性和完
整性,防止数据被窃听和篡改。
SIM卡通过加密算法对通信内容进行加密,只有具有相应解密密钥的设备才能解密
和读取通信内容。加密机制可以确保通信的机密性和安全性。
6. SIM卡的应用
SIM卡通信原理的基本原理适用于各种移动设备和应用场景。SIM卡广泛应用于手
机、平板电脑、物联网设备等,支持了各种通信和业务功能的实现。
SIM卡的应用包括但不限于以下几个方面:
•
•
•
•
电话和短信:SIM卡支持电话和短信功能,用户可以通过SIM卡进行通话和
发送接收短信。
数据传输:SIM卡支持数据传输功能,用户可以通过SIM卡进行互联网访问、
邮件收发等。
身份认证:SIM卡可以用于身份认证,如银行卡、门禁卡等。
增值服务:SIM卡支持各种增值服务,如支付、定位、车载通信等。
SIM卡的应用广泛且多样,为用户提供了丰富的通信和业务功能。
结论
SIM卡通信原理涉及到SIM卡与设备、移动网络运营商之间的通信过程,包括SIM
卡的识别、鉴权、加密等功能。SIM卡通过物理接口和逻辑接口与设备进行通信,
通过与运营商的鉴权和注册实现接入移动网络,并支持数据通信和业务功能的实现。
SIM卡通信原理的基本原理是SIM卡与设备、运营商之间的安全通信,保障了通信
的安全性和合法性。SIM卡的应用广泛且多样,为用户提供了丰富的通信和业务功
能。
版权声明:本文标题:sim卡通信原理 内容由热心网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:https://www.elefans.com/xitong/1715482616a454446.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论